Problem

Existing paint bucket hooks for extension ladders are cumbersome, unsafe, and inefficient, particularly due to the lack of an easy-to-grip handle, which slows down painters and increases risk at high elevations, and often cater only to right-handed users.

Innovation Solution

A paint bucket ladder hook with a closed grip design handle that allows secure attachment and easy maneuverability of paint cans on extension ladders, suitable for both right and left-handed users, featuring a spring snap hook and a rectangular grip handle for one-handed operation.

Data Source

PatentUS7438267B2Paint bucket ladder hook with closed grip design handle
Publication Date: 2008.10.21 MONTELEONE VITO

AI summary

A ladder rung hook (122) and upper horizontal frame (124) intersect to create an embodiment for a gripping vertical handle (126). This handle makes it faster, safer, and easy for a user to move a can of paint from rung to rung on an extension ladder. Left or right-handed painters can maneuver their can of paint with our unique easy to grip handle. A lower spring snap hook (138) will easily hook to a can of paint. The ladder hook (122) will simply be hung to the ladder rung through the easy to grip handle.
